Excerpt from The Jesuit Missions: A Chronicle of the Cross, in the Wilderness

When the friars reached Quebec they arranged a division of labour in this manner: Jamay and Du Plessis were to remain at Quebec, d'olbeau was to return to Tadoussac and essay the thorny task of converting the tribes round that fishing and trading station while to Le Caron was assigned a more distant field, but one that promised a rich harvest. Six or seven hundred miles from Quebec, in the region of Lake Simcoe and the Georgian Bay, dwelt the Hurons, a sedentary people living in villages and practising a rude agridestruct.
